Daughter of William Edward Dickenson & Mary Wade.
Informant: T J McKee (Son)
Wife of Frances Alonzo McKee
Census data:
1860: Talladega County, Alabama
William A Dickenson (66, Scotland) Head, laborer
Josephine (22, NC)
Mary (19 AL)
1870: Beat No. 3, Neshoba, Mississippi
Francis A McKee (24, AL) Head, farmer
Mary E (27, AL) Wife
Young A (1 month, May 1870, Miss) Son
Josephine Dickenson (34, NC) sister-in-law?
1880: Keys Valley, Bell County, Texas
F. A. McKee (33, AL) Head, farmer
M. E. (35, AL) Wife
Richard (10, TX) Son
William (7, TX) Son
Ola (4, TX) Daughter
Willburn (1, TX) Son
Jo Church (6, Miss) Nephew
Georgia Ellis (17, Miss) Niece
(Next door to)
T.J. McKee & 8 family members, Clark McKee & 4 family members, and T Wiley McKee & 4 family members)
1900: JP7, Bell County, Texas
Francis McKee (55, Oct 1844, AL) Head, Blacksmith
Mary E (56, Oct 1843, AL) Wife, married 33 yrs, 5 of 6 children living
(Living next door to newly married son Thomas Jefferson)
T. J. McKee (28, Oct 1871, TX) Head, farmer
Myrtle (19, May 1881, TX) Wife, married 0 yrs
1910: JP4, Coppers Cove, Coryell County, Texas
South 2nd Street
Francis A McKee (59, AL) Head – carpenter
Mary (60, AL) Wife, married 39 yrs, 4 of 6 children living
